Visual Analysis of the Tattoo

This tattoo presents a strikingly dramatic image of a cherry seemingly crushed or splattered against a surface. The artist has masterfully captured the texture of the fruit and the fluidity of the juice, using realistic shading and highlights. The composition is dynamic and unsettling, conveying a sense of impact and fragility. The placement on the back of the neck is somewhat unconventional, adding to the tattoo’s rebellious and edgy appeal.

Artistic Style and Technical Execution

The style is hyperrealistic, demanding exceptional technical skill from the tattoo artist. The ability to replicate textures and create a sense of depth is crucial. Achieving this level of realism requires meticulous attention to detail and a thorough understanding of light and shadow.

Symbolism and Cultural Significance

While cherries typically symbolize sweetness and love, this tattoo subverts those expectations. The smashed cherry could represent loss, heartbreak, or the fragility of life. It could also symbolize a destructive force or a moment of intense emotion. The placement on the back of the neck, a vulnerable area, suggests a willingness to confront these difficult themes.
